MATTER OF RODRIGUEZ v. STATE OF NEW YORK DEPT. OF CORRECTIONS & COMMUNITY SUPERVISION

521881.

140 A.D.3d 1455 (2016)

32 N.Y.S.3d 520

2016 NY Slip Op 04773

In the Matter of CARLOS RODRIGUEZ, Appellant, v. STATE OF NEW YORK DEPARTMENT OF CORRECTIONS AND COMMUNITY SUPERVISION, Respondent.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, Third Department.

Decided June 16, 2016.


Petitioner commenced this CPLR article 78 proceeding seeking to expunge allegedly inaccurate mental health information contained in his security classification records. In lieu of an answer, respondent moved to dismiss the petition as moot on the ground that the objectionable information has since been deleted. Supreme Court granted the motion and this appeal ensued.
